Polycarbonate was developed for applications where failure is not an option. Unlike acrylic, which prioritizes surface hardness and optical clarity, polycarbonate was engineered for impact resistance, toughness, and structural reliability under load.

You’ll find polycarbonate in machine guards, safety shields, enclosures, lenses, and structural panels where flexibility and durability matter more than brittleness. It can absorb shock, flex without cracking, and survive conditions that would shatter acrylic or glass. That resilience is why it became a standard material in industrial, automotive, and safety-critical environments.

Polycarbonate machines differently from acrylic. It is tougher and more forgiving under impact, but softer at the surface. It benefits from sharp tooling, controlled feeds, and attention to heat management to avoid melting or edge fusion. When handled correctly, it drills, profiles, and pockets cleanly, making it well-suited for guards, enclosures, functional panels, and parts that must survive real-world use.
